Abstract
The Age of Information (AoI) has emerged as a critical performance metric for evaluating time-sensitive wireless communications systems, where maintaining freshness of information and transmission reliability is crucial. In modern ultra-reliable low-latency communication networks, short-packet transmissions are essential for energy efficiency and low latency. This paper introduces Agenet, an open-source Python package designed to estimate AoI in cooperative wireless networks. It implements a system model over Rayleigh fading channels, combining finite blocklength information theory and AoI analysis. The package offers tools to calculate signal-to-noise ratio, block error rate, and both theoretical and simulated AoI. By enabling analysis of AoI performance under various network configurations, Agenet supports research and development of efficient wireless systems for time-critical applications.
